Ok, where to start...  I guess the first thing to establish is the objective. This is affected by the fact that the car's pedigree can't be established as the door plates were lost in the mists of time. So we don't know much about the car other than it is a 1966 Coupe with a 2bbl 289 built in San Jose.

Unfortunately, the San Jose plant did not use buck tags... so it's all but impossible to know what the car should have looked like.  There is a very small chance that there is a build sheet hidden in the car, but most likely not as the San Jose plant procedures dictated throwing them out.  You never know your luck though.

The backup plan is to treat her as a clean slate and do her up really nice.  The seller had a number of parts and accessories to fit her out with a brilliant blue pony interior.  After a bit of research, this is what we're hoping to achieve.
